Snowflake vs Cloudera Data Platform (CDP)
psychology AI Verdict
Cloudera Data Platform (CDP) excels in offering a comprehensive big data management solution that integrates SQL queries, real-time analytics, and machine learning capabilities. It boasts advanced security features such as fine-grained access control and encryption at rest and in transit, making it suitable for organizations with stringent compliance requirements. On the other hand, Snowflake shines in its cloud-native architecture, providing seamless scalability and performance without the need for hardware management.
However, CDP's integration of machine learning directly within the platform sets it apart from Snowflake, which primarily focuses on data warehousing. While both platforms offer robust security features, CDPs comprehensive approach to big data analytics makes it a more versatile choice for organizations that require end-to-end data management solutions. Conversely, Snowflakes superior performance and ease of use in handling large-scale data warehousing tasks make it the preferred option for those focused on advanced analytics and reporting.
thumbs_up_down Pros & Cons
check_circle Pros
- High performance and scalability
- User-friendly interface
- Pay-per-use pricing model
cancel Cons
- Limited feature set compared to CDP
- Primarily focused on data warehousing
check_circle Pros
- Comprehensive big data management solution
- Advanced security features
- Integration with machine learning
cancel Cons
- Steeper learning curve
- More complex pricing model
difference Key Differences
help When to Choose
- If you prioritize high performance and scalability in a cloud-based data warehousing environment
- If you choose Snowflake if ease of use and pay-per-use pricing model are important factors
- If you choose Snowflake if your organization focuses on advanced analytics tasks
- If you prioritize a comprehensive big data management solution that includes SQL queries, real-time analytics, and machine learning capabilities.
- If you choose Cloudera Data Platform (CDP) if your organization requires robust security features for sensitive data
- If you choose Cloudera Data Platform (CDP) if end-to-end data management is crucial